Philanthropy + Capitalist = Philanthrocapitalist??



A new breed of philanthropists have emerged from around the world that seek to apply the same zeal to donating money as they do to making it.

The following article from the Wall Street Journal hightlights some top philanthropists and charity executives and asks them how they would spend $10 billion to best alleviate the world's problems.

While the answers ranged from infrastructure and entrepreneurship to global health and education they all shared similar paths for achieving such lofty goals: due diligence, transparency and accountability - "ideas that thrive on quantifiable data".
